DUBAI, United Arab Emirates--(BUSINESS WIRE)--UAE-based MaritimeIndustrial Services Co. Ltd. Inc. (OSE:MIS) continues the successin its new-build programme with the signing of rig-buildingcontracts worth US$335m for the detail design and construction oftwo offshore jack-up drilling rigs for Mosvold Middle East Jackup(MEJU).
With this award, MIS is now positioned with a mid-2008 confirmedorder backlog of US$480m, an increase of US$110m on its firmbacklog at this time last year, excluding the two Orion rigssubsequently deleted from backlog. The two firm rigs (Hull 106 andHull 108), will be supplied by MIS on a turnkey basis and will bebuilt at MIS' shipyard in Sharjah, UAE.
"Our strong relationship with MIS continues with this new contract.With their reputation as a professional yard and their performanceon the first two rigs, our decision to build at MIS was madeeasier," said Mr. Roy Mosvold, Chairman of MEJU. "The Middle Eastis the fastest growing jack-up market and we look forward tofurther developing our relationship with MIS as together we addressthe demand for more new rigs in this market."
Moreover, Jerry Smith, MIS Managing Director, said: "We are verypleased to receive this repeat order from Mosvold and we see it asan important one to further cement MIS' position as the offshorejack-up rig builder of choice in the Middle East." "We expect theinterest in our new-build programme to continue over the next fewyears and we are continually looking for opportunities to expandour yard facilities by seeking out ideal locations in the UAE,"said Smith.
The two rigs, Hulls 106 and 108, are a Friede and Goldman (F&G)Super Mod 2 design with 30,000 foot rated drilling depth and anoperating water depth capability of 300 feet and with accommodationfor 110 people on each rig.
Source: ME NewsWire.
About Maritime Industrial Services: MIS is a Panamanian registered company with its major fabricationbase and shipyard in Sharjah, UAE and has approx. 5,000 employees.The company was founded in 1979 and has 29 years of profitableoperating history.
